LP12 cartridge choice


I have an LP 12 with Ekos arm. Currently with Benz MO9
with AR PH3SE phono preamp. Wondering if Lyra Helikon, or Van Den Hul Frog, or Koetsu ? what would be a good upgrade ?
I do have cirkus and trampolin, but no lingo...should I do that first ?

This is an easy one, get the lingo. Many years ago my dealer set up an LP 12, Ekos,Troika and another LP 12 with the Lingo,Ittok,K9. The LP 12 with the Lingo sounded better. To this day I'm still shocked. If you have the bucks get the Lingo and a Benz Ruby 2. The Benz works very well with the Ekos, in my view better than the Arkiv which I had before. It will out track the Arkiv and has no rising top end.
